Household energy storage method and system with charging and discharging current reduction strategy
A home energy storage and charging current limiting technology, applied in the field of electronics, can solve problems such as overload work, hidden dangers, and impact on battery life, so as to enhance the safety factor, prolong battery life, and reduce the probability of full load or overload operation. [0037] Such as figure 1As shown, the present invention discloses a household energy storage method with a charging and discharging current reduction strategy, comprising the following steps:
[0038] Polling step: the inverter issues a polling command;
[0039] Verification step: whether the battery system verification data is complete, if yes, execute the charging judgment step, otherwise end.
[0040] Charging judging step: judging whether the battery system is charging, if so, then execute the charging current limiting step, otherwise execute the discharging current limiting step.
[0041] The charging current limiting step includes the following four parts:
